        A year of time that took in 539-538 B.C. is one of the key years in the history of the Jewish people. In that year, King Cyrus of Persia, who had just conquered Babylon, issued an edict to allow the Jews to return to Jerusalem after 70 years in exile. Ezra, who was a priest and scribe who went to Jerusalem in 458 B.C., wrote of the history of that return and then of his ministry. In the history, he was inspired to give a detail of those who returned after the edict. Chapter two of Ezra is part of that detail. It consists of lists of people, who went, the families and towns they were connected to and what their positions were.

Paul tells Timothy in 2 Timothy 3:16, “All Scripture is inspired by God and is profitable for teaching. . .” This information in this chapter was important to God’s people who came out of Babylon and returned to the Promised Land. It is important for us. It reminds me that God not only uses people, but God knows His people. He knew them then and He knows us now. Thank God for His love and grace for you.
